2.7.2.6 Emergency fire phones (a two-way voice communication<br />

system) shall be provided <strong>in</strong> lieu of manual call po<strong>in</strong>ts <strong>in</strong> the<br />

station public areas such that a person needs not travel more<br />

than 90m to an emergency fire phone on any level to report a<br />

fire. The Passenger Service Centre (PSC), where provided, can<br />

be considered as a report<strong>in</strong>g station.<br />

2.7.2.7 For underground station, two-way emergency voice<br />

communication shall be provided between the <strong>Fire</strong> Command<br />

Centre (FCC) or <strong>in</strong> the absence of which, the ma<strong>in</strong> alarm panel<br />

(MAP) and the follow<strong>in</strong>g:<br />

(a) Every fire fight<strong>in</strong>g lobby;<br />

(b) <strong>Fire</strong> pump room;<br />

(c) <strong>Fire</strong> lift;<br />

(d) Local manual control <strong>for</strong> smoke control equipment;<br />

(e) All lift motor rooms;<br />

(f) Passenger Service Centre (PSC); and<br />

(g) Air-handl<strong>in</strong>g control rooms if a manual on/off switch<br />

<strong>for</strong> the station’s central air-condition<strong>in</strong>g system is not<br />

provided <strong>in</strong> the PSC.<br />

2.7.2.8 <strong>Fire</strong>men <strong>in</strong>tercom shall be provided <strong>for</strong> communication<br />

between the space where the tunnel dry ma<strong>in</strong>s breech<strong>in</strong>g <strong>in</strong>lets<br />

are located at ground level and the buffer areas. The <strong>in</strong>tercom<br />

unit at the buffer areas shall be located near the access stairs at<br />

the plat<strong>for</strong>m lead<strong>in</strong>g to the track level.<br />

2.7.2.9 Underground stations shall be provided with radio<br />

communication facilities capable of operat<strong>in</strong>g <strong>in</strong> the frequency<br />

band of 470 – 490 MHz range.<br />
